Terracotta column-krater (mixing bowl)
Painter of the Bari Orestes
ca. 375–350 BCE · Terracotta · Greek and Roman Art

Obverse, woman and two Oscan youths Reverse, three youths The figures carry paraphernalia for an observance—trays with cakes, a nestoris (an Italic type of jar), and a bunch of grapes that suggests a Dionysiac connection.
